Applied in person in store and application was promptly taken to manager's office. Got a call a day or so later from the location and spoke to a department manager.
Very informal interview- answered behavioral questions like
1. Would you report a theft by an employee? etc etc
Also made sure I said that you ask relevant questions to customers. That the manager seemed to like,
After that, the next day I spoke to the store manager and an offer was made
